IRMA THOMAS

Simply Grand

2008-08-12

"Simply Grand" -- a simply great concept for a simply great blues artist. Irma Thomas pairs up with 12 accomplished blues/jazz pianists and allows their keyboard work to gracefully adorn her signature vocals. Highlights include the songs with Henry Butler(#1, doing a John Fogerty tune), Dr. John (#2 and #8), Jon Clary (#3), Norah Jones (#7) and John Medeski (#11). Medeski's relentless piano pounding is particularly well done and I think the Butler and Jones cuts are also mighty fine. Irma is finally getting her due. After an early overlooked career, the "Soul Queen of New Orleans" was brought back into the spotlight by Rounder in the late '90s. We're all musically better for that. 08/08 MJVD B-Diva
